Information Security Engineer

Cisco

Senior Splunk Engineer leading migration of on-premise Splunk to Cloud. Collaborating with SOC and engineering teams to enhance security monitoring and data ingestion.

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Lead the end-to-end migration of our on-premise Splunk Enterprise environment to Splunk Cloud
  • Serve as the primary technical liaison between SOC and engineering teams
  • Translate business needs into actionable dashboards, alerts, and reports
  • Manage lifecycle activities including patching, upgrades, and configuration rollouts using automation tools like Ansible and GitLab
  • Optimize data pipelines to ensure compliance with the Common Information Model (CIM) and organizational security standards
  • Proactively tune system performance, resolve ingestion bottlenecks, and implement security and compliance controls

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• 5+ years of experience in Splunk administration and engineering
  • Proven expertise in migrating complex Splunk architectures from on-premise to SaaS environments
  • Advanced knowledge of Splunk Enterprise and Splunk Cloud, including indexer clusters and search head clustering
  • Strong scripting skills in Python, PowerShell, or Bash for automation of tasks
  • Experience with cloud platforms such as AWS or Azure and networking fundamentals
  • Familiarity with SOC environments, security frameworks, incident response, and log analysis
  • Splunk Certified Administrator or Architect certification (preferred)
  • Security certifications such as CompTIA Security+ or equivalent (preferred)
  • Experience leading cross-functional teams and collaborating effectively with SOC and engineering groups (preferred)
